Abstract :
SINCE turbine-generator rotors are highly stressed structures that combine materials of widely varying properties, unbalance may be caused by geometrical errors, non-homogeneity of materials, or distortion under the speed and temperature of operating conditions. The purpose of balancing is to offset these imperfections by adjustment of the rotor mass distribution so as to secure a rotor which will run so smoothly that only small periodic forces will be transmitted to the supporting bearings and foundation.
